
Pastor Louis Kotzé discusses the urgency of living an active faith based on the teachings of the Second Letter of Peter.
The Second Letter of Peter gives us access to some of the apostle Peter’s final words – written with urgency, clarity, and deep concern for the future of the Church. In a world that is temporary and feels uncertain, Peter calls believers to anchor their lives in what is eternal. In this message, Pastor Louis zooms in on 2 Peter 1, reminding us that we have everything we need in Jesus to live godly lives. For this reason, we are urged to make every effort to grow in faith, character, and love, and to remain firmly grounded in truth. In the face of cultural drift and misleading voices, passivity is not an option.
